Tag: The Explorer


  • Kevin

    Kevin is a bike courier and Los Angeles beach bum who first suspected something was strange when he surfed all the way from Long Beach to Malibu. On one wave. In five minutes. Since that time, he's been seeking what he calls [[The Swiss Cheese | holes …